Mercer v. Rainegreen1 sentence2004See Mercer v. Raine, 443 So.2d 944, 946 (Fla.1983) (holding, in case where trial court entered default judgment against defendant for failure to comply with discovery order, that abuse of discretion "test should apply to the discretionary power of the trial court to grant sanctions"); Carr v. Reese, 788 So.2d 1067, 1070 (Fla. 2d DCA 2001) ("We recognize that a trial court's decision imposing sanctions for discovery violations must be affirmed unless the trial court abused its discretion in imposing the sanction at issue."). | 1 | 1 |

Kozel v. Ostendorf
green
1 sentence2021Such discretion is not unbridled, however, as it is widely presumed the interests of justice are best served by resolving cases on their merits. 2 The homeowners correctly argue that where the actions of counsel are implicated, the trial court must consider the six factors established in the seminal case of Kozel v. Ostendorf, 629 So. 2d 817 (Fla. 1993) to determine whether dismissal is appropriate and set forth explicit findings of fact in an order imposing the sanction of dismissal. | 1 | 2021–2021 |

Warriner v. Ferraro
green
1 sentence1971In Warriner v. Ferraro, 177 So.2d 723 (Fla.App. 1965), where plaintiff had failed to furnish a list of witnesses to defendants pursuant to court order, it was held that the court had inherent power to impose the sanction of dismissal for a failure to comply with a court order. | 1 | 1971–1971 |
